Output ae3aaf3c73b43a91a779a475aa0a05affd1e4307afd40cf09a17ad3ff57bfd53:0

value
48327138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 073f5c8ed82ef3399c9315f66c4a7dc102867c01 OP_EQUAL
address
32MLZKn5iaXKpCswHstmxLsGFPzQSvbNgz
transaction
ae3aaf3c73b43a91a779a475aa0a05affd1e4307afd40cf09a17ad3ff57bfd53
confirmations
446089
spent
true